Model selection results from cubic spline model fitted to female chamois body mass data.

Specifically, we allowed α0 and β0 to be constant across years (α0; β0), vary linearly with year (α0(y); β0(y)), quadratically with year (α0(y2); β0(y2)) or linearly with population density (α0(d); β0(d)). Maximum log-likelihoods (LL) and ΔAICs are shown for each site. The most parsimonious models for each site are highlighted in bold (i.e. have a ΔAIC value that is ≤6 and lower than all simpler nested versions; see Richards [40]). n is sample size for each site.
